It is permitted to appoint the judge, the Muhtasib (judge of public rights) and the Mazalim in a general capacity, to judge in all matters all over the State. It is also permitted to appoint them in a specific capacity, whether geographic or according to a certain type of judiciary. This would be in accordance with the action of the Messenger of Allah (pbuh). He (pbuh) appointed Ali Ibnu Abi Talib as judge over Yemen, and Mu’az Ibnu Jabal as judge over an area of Yemen, and He also appointed ‘Amru Ibn al-‘A‘as as judge in one specific matter.
Reference: The Ruling System in Islam - Abdul Qadeem Zalloom
